I have been on Tri-Mix for about 3 years and am noticing a decreasing effect of the injection. The formula is 15mg Papaverine, 0.5 mg Phentolamine, 25mcg Alprostadil. I started out at 15 units on the syringe. I am now up to 25 units and then often have to inject an additional 5 units.

Questions/Issues:

1) Is this a low, medium, or high formula?
2) What is a Unit on the syringe? How much?
3) After about 45 minutes I start to lose the erection when my wife gets on top of me. (This is the only way she can achieve orgasm), and have to inject the 2nd dose.
4) However, after just one or both injections I stay hard for 3+ hours.
5) Is the medicine starting to lose the effect or do I need a stronger dose or different formula?
6) If I need a stronger dose, what would it be?


Any guidance much appreciated. This isn't easy.

It's a medium-low dosage. A "unit" is 1/100th of a milliter (ml). A syringe usually holds 100 units or 1 ml, I've had some that hold 30 units.

I started with PGE only (in Caverject) for a year and had to slowly increase from 20-40mcg. The volume was high and burn was bad. So . . . Switched to TM started with 30-1-20 at 20-30 units (0.30ml). Was hitting it pretty hard 2-3 times a week and noticed likewise a drop off in efficacy and when goiong longer. Pushed it up a bit and occasionally supplemented with 5-10 mcg PGE. Likewise found after an initial surge that the fella backed off in 15-20 minutes. Wifey wanted more so hit it with another 10 units. I'm now using 30-2-40 and 20 units. Just coming off a 3 1/2 month layoff due to a surgery/recovery, virus and pneumonia, and a remodel with guys tramping all over for 2 months now. right off the bat, I have noticed a better effect at a lower dose. As with pills, we seem to get accustomed to it and some end up updosing and getting more into a burn/pain zone. There may also be a correlation with anorgasmia with higher doses over time (me).

A separate issue is position. There are several posts here about guys only being hard in a standing, missionary or side-saddle position - including me. They go pretty limp on their backs. Some have offered theories but I've hear no definitive reason. Fortunately wifey goes ballistic in any position as long as it's long and hard, but 30-45 min is her limit.

I'm not a medical professional of any kind. Anything I post is based on my own experiences, at best, and hallucinations or delusions, at worst. Remember, internet forum advice is often worth exactly what you paid for it. Always ask your doctor and follow his/her advice.

Before making any changes, try the same dose a 2nd time paying particular attention to your injection technique. If the same result, and with doctor approval, bump it 5 units. 15 units isn't a huge amount, especially considering the mix you have. That does seem to be a weak script. If you eventually figure out your correct dose is 30 units of that mix you can ask him to double the strength so you can roll it back to 15 units. But I see no reason not to use what you have to experiment with. I'm using 12 units of some pretty strong stuff.
